Raspberry Smoothie Bowl

When a smoothie bowl is dairy free, sweetener free, and this full of flavor I could eat one every day. This Raspberry Smoothie Bowl is easy to make and delicious. The color comes from frozen raspberries and frozen cherries (which also add extra sweet flavor).

If you missed it on my last smoothie bowl post… my secret to getting a thick smoothie? Almost like ice cream and fluffy without breaking my blender? I use my food processor instead! It has a much easier time pureeing these ingredients and keeping it thick. For a smoothie bowl it works much better when it’s thick. You should try it in your food processor too! 

Raspberry Smoothie Bowl

Author Shannon | Plum Street

Ingredients

  • 2/3 c. coconut milk
  • 1 frozen banana
  • 2 medjool dates pitted
  • 2 c. frozen raspberries
  • 1 c. frozen cherries

Instructions

  • In food processor blend coconut milk, frozen banana, and dates until pureed.
  • Then add frozen raspberries and cherries. Blend until smooth.
  • Pour into bowl and top with coconut and raspberries, or anything else you'd like (granola, almonds).
